At the moment a blazing comet flies overhead, Purslane is born. And her mother dies.

Purlane's father is enraged when she shows no sign of a mystical ability gifted by the comet. Desolate, he sells her to a farmer. Purslane escapes and embarks on a perilous quest to find her mother's family. On her journey, she discovers the mysteries surrounding her birth, and that her name is really Luna.

When she uncovers the abandoned red canoe, it-as if guided by unseen powers-propels her to the safely of Huldor's Inn. There Luna finds a loving home until...

Lady Magda arrives with Selene -Luna's twin. Lady Magda enchants Luna with exciting promises of travel and telling fortunes! The lure to be with her long-lost sister is tempting. Should she go? Or stay where she has found a home?
